Doda Police Seized Matadoor For Overloading, FIR Registered
Dec, 10. 2024.
On the directions of SSP Doda Sh Sandeep Metha JKPS , a drive to curb the visible traffic violations was started in the Doda District. Accordingly, acting on the directions, today on 10.12.2024 during motor vehicle checking/regulation in Bhaderwah, a Matadoor bearing registration No Jk08B /3165 found overloaded by 14 passengers against seating capacity which was seized on the spot.
The Matadoor was driven by driver, namely Sahil Aryan S/o Ram prashad R/o Misrata Bhalra, in a rash and negligent manner , thus endangering the lives of the passengers. A case FIR No. 179/2024 under section 281, 125 BNS , 194(1) MV act registered at PS Bhaderwah and Investigation of the set into the motion.
SSP Doda has warned the drivers to desist from the violation of traffic rules else stringent action will be taken against the erring drivers which includes suspension of driving license, route permit besides registration of FIRs.
